Junior Python-разработчик

Основное


Город
Готовность к релокации

Не указано

Описание

Проживание: Самара

Ищу работу на позицию python-разработчика. Рассматриваю вакансии на полную занятость в удаленном формате.
На текущий момент завершил обучение Hexlet на профессию Python-разработчик.

Завершил 4 из 4 учебных проекта:

Игры разума

Набор математических мини-игр, запускаемых в консоли.

В рамках проекта познакомился с:
- настройкой окружения
- работой в командной строке
- работой с poetry
- работой с Git
- настройкой CI (Github actions)
- применением flake8

Стэк: Python, Poetry, Flake8, Git, GitHub Actions (CI)

Вычислитель отличий

Консольное приложение, позволяющее сравнивать две структуры данных и показывать отличия между ними.

В рамках проекта познакомился с:
- работой с разными форматами данных: json, yaml
- написанием unit-тестов c помощью pytest
- использованием фикстур
- созданием cli-приложения и оформлением справочной информации о приложении
- работе с рекурсией

Стэк: Python, Poetry, PyYAML, Flake8, Pytest, Pytest-cov

Загрузчик страниц

Приложение, которое может работать как консольное и как библиотека для скачивания переданных HTML страниц, всех локальных ресурсов страницы и изменение пути до них в конченом HTML файле.

В рамках проекта познакомился с:
- работой с библиотекой requests
- работа с DOM с применением библиотеки beautifulsoup4
- обработка ошибок
- логирование приложения
- написание тестов с применением requests-mock
- работа с прогресс баром

Стэк: Python, Poetry, requests, beautifulsoup4, flake8, pytest, pytest-cov, requests-mock

Менеджер задач

Это простое веб-приложение для управления задачами в компании или команде. В приложении реализована регистрация новых пользователей, аутентификация. Можно создавать новые задачи, статусы и метки, назначать исполнителей задач. Пользователь может редактировать свою учетную запись, изменять информацию и пароль.

Пока пользователь участвует в задании, его учетная запись не может быть удалена. Пока задаче присвоен статус или метка, она не может быть удалена.

В рамках проекта познакомился с:
- фреймворком Django
- Bootstrap
- деплой на Railway
- Организация логирования ошибок с помощью Rollbar

Стэк: Python, Poetry, Django, Bootstrap, django-filter, flake8, railway, rollbar

Навыки
  • Python (опыт учебных проектов на hexlet и написание автотестов back сервисов)
  • Уверенный пользователь linux/windows
  • Опыт работы с jira/confluence
  • Опыт работы с git
  • Проектирование и разработка структур БД и ХП (MSSQL/T-SQL)
  • Опыт работы с postman
  • Опыт управление командой из 2х аналитиков, 2 разработчиков (web/mobile) и 1 тестировщика.
  • Опыт планирования задач на команду на спринт и на квартал.
  • Опыт поддержки решений в продакшен контуре
  • Опыт работы с pytest написание автотестов для API сервисов
Владение английским
Начальные знания
Контакт
Телеграм: https://t.me/Tuyweoit Телефон: +7-996-341-71-84 Почта: sidorenkovav@hotmail.com

Работа


Systems analyst, КлаудФэктори
Ноябрь 2019 - по настоящее время
  • Разработка мобильного приложения для работы с финансовым рынком
  • Разработка web приложения для работы с клиентами.
  • Управление командой аналитиков, разработчиков и тестировщиков
  • Планирование ресурсов и состава спринта
  • Взаимодействие с заказчиком (банк из топ-5)
  • Декомпозиция задач
  • Создание back2back, front2back сервисов
  • Проектирование методов АПИ
  • Проектирование и разработка структуры БД и ХП
  • Согласование архитектуры приложения

Достижение:
* Спустя 1.5 года работы продвинулся от Junior Системного Аналитика к Старшему Аналитику.

Образование


Электромеханика, СамГТУ
Сентябрь 2010 - Сентябрь 2015

Комментарии

Рекомендации

Ожидает подтверждения
0

Привет, Антон!
Давай остановимся на Описании и проработаем его с точки зрения структуры.
У каждого ресурса, где размещается резюме, своя структура и ее нужно учитывать.
1. Описание.
В описании предлагаю начать с основной цели: какие вакансии рассматриваешь, язык разработки, формат работы (офис/гибрид/удаленно), город проживания.
Дату рождения можно не указывать, контакты для связи и ссылки на профили -вынести в раздел Контакты.
2. Учебные проекты.
Их необходимо включить: описать суть проекта, полученные навыки и стек. Примером описания проектов может послужить: https://cv.hexlet.io/resumes/701#answer-587
5. Добавить фото на GitHub и продолжать с ним качественно работать.
6. Контакты. Мы договорились, что из верхней части нам нужно отнести их в этот раздел.
7. Работа.
Было бы здоров отметить свои достижения/успехи за этот период работы.

Удачи тебе в поисках новых предложений!


Добавить комментарий
Для этого действия нужновойти
Войдите на сайт, чтобы написать ответ
Последние ответы
В разделе "Контакт" проверьте написание
Привет, Матвей! Отличное резюме:) Желаю интересных и развивающих проектов в IT!
Привет, Оксана! Есть несколько дополнений к резюме: 1. Давай укажем также комфортный ...
Привет, Алена! Молодец:) Давай только добавим еще один контакт для связи с тобой, это...
Привет, Полина! Спасибо за резюме, выглядит отлично:) Есть предложения: 1. В описа...
Дмитрий, привет! Отличное резюме :) Добавь, пожалуйста, в описание комфортный формат ...
Привет, Алишер! Отличное резюме :) Успехов тебе в достижении цели!
Данил, привет! Отличное начало :) Давай в название учебных проектов включим ссылку на...
Привет, Артем! Отличное резюме :) Пополняй его новыми проектами и достижениями в IT! ...
Юлия, привет! Отличное резюме:) Будет здорово добавить фотографию в профиль Github. ...